Output e08020f1334f5ce55d5fb2beae433d8c06f78dae7ad97e6bbf4acdfd530f0e05:0

value
2346088678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0396474700f8f2947b2a8cc5d6c65b6c9cb64a6b OP_EQUAL
address
321yyeWAfpnHrGZMirhP1kE4ueyWsytqeW
transaction
e08020f1334f5ce55d5fb2beae433d8c06f78dae7ad97e6bbf4acdfd530f0e05
confirmations
389074
spent
true